Abstract

Business performance measurement (BPM) is a fast evolving and diverse research field which features highly on the agenda of academics and practitioners from functions including general management, accounting, operations research, marketing, and human resources. Utilizing a citation analysis this paper identifies the following challenges for the field of BPM. The balanced scorecard seems to be the most influential and dominant concept in the field. Researchers are encouraged to further test and discuss its theoretical foundation and research methodology. The second challenge is to create a cohesive body of knowledge in the field of BPM.
